Parliament College of Health Science and Technology, Yauri in Kebbi state is to partner with Medical Laboratory Science Council of Nigeria, MLSCN, in improving the status and capacity of medical laboratory science technology across the nation.
The registrar of the Board and team leader of the reaccreditation team to the College, Dr. Tosan Erhabour, stated that this during accreditation exercise in yauri.
Dr Tosan expressed satisfaction with the efforts of the College in ensuring that students are provided with conducive environment for learning.
He also commended the management of Parliament College of Health Science and Technology, Yauri, for providing adequate manpower and equipment for the training of medical laboratory technicians .
In his response, the chairman of the College’s Governing Board, Alhaji Abdullahi Yelwa, Ajiyan Yauri, commended the MLSCN Board for it’s untiring efforts to sanitize medical laboratory science education in the country .
Alhaji Abdullahi Yalwa stressed the need for the council to ensure that only schools that meet the standards of the Board and granted accreditation.
The chairman promised to maintain the high standard of learning, training and research in the College .
He called on wealthy individuals in the state to support fledgeling private higher institutions in Kebbi State.
The College was granted permission by MLSCN board to commence training of Medical Laboratory technicians on 17th March, 2020, following an accreditation visit.
In the 2022 National Examination of the Board, the College scored 100 percent pass.
The t College has been accredited by National Board for Technical Education, NBTE; the Community Health Practitioners Registration Board of Nigeria, CHPRBN; West African Examinations Board, WAHEB, and the Medical Laboratory Science Council of Nigeria, MLSCN.
